Output 4881cc21cf906381252283502eaf067e1828326e91663077981a2be045e9dbb6:29

value
169921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d3c0659b7f2298a49614337c6ea39bec1de3c5a OP_EQUAL
address
38jPrup6HZpcL92karUdoNH2WoJAe4KCVE
transaction
4881cc21cf906381252283502eaf067e1828326e91663077981a2be045e9dbb6
spent
true